In "The War of Independence," John Fiske presents a detailed and nuanced analysis of the American Revolution, intertwining historical narrative with philosophical reflection. Fiske's literary style is characterized by eloquence and clarity, making complex historical events accessible to both scholarly and general audiences. He situates the conflict within the broader context of Enlightenment thought and national identity, exploring the ideological underpinnings that fueled the revolutionaries' struggle against British tyranny. Through an integrative approach, Fiske examines military strategies, pivotal battles, and the socio-political dynamics that shaped the young nation'Äôs fight for autonomy. John Fiske, a prominent American historian and philosopher, was deeply influenced by the intellectual currents of his time, including Darwinian theory and liberal democracy. His rich background in philosophy and history provided him with the analytical tools necessary to dissect the significance of the American Revolution. Fiske's commitment to understanding the past was rooted in a desire to elucidate the foundations of American democracy and uncover the lessons that history offers for contemporary society. Readers interested in a thorough exploration of the American Revolution will find "The War of Independence" highly engaging and illuminating. Fiske's insightful perspectives not only enhance our understanding of this pivotal event but also challenge us to reflect on the values that underpin our modern democratic ideals.
